INSURANCE PREMIUMS.

THEFTS BY COLLECTOR.

[BY TELEGRAPH.— ASSOCIATION - , DARGAVILLE. Totirsday.

In the Magistrate's Court, Robert Coe v.as charged that, having received 15 sums amounting to £35 8s 3d on account of the Provident Life Assurance Company, he did fradulently ornit to account for same, thereby committing theft over a period extending from 1916 to 1922. The accused, who pleaded guiHy, nan committed to the Auckland Supreme Court for sentence, Bml was allowed.
